BWV 577 is number 6 of the so called "Schübler" chorales. Bach frequently used the pedal division to sound the Cantus or melody of his choral prelude settings, but in this case, the Cantus is played by various solo instruments, including the Flugelhorn, French Horn and English Horn.
The bass is played by the left hand using light foundation stops on the Great division. The right hand plays a flowing and lyrical passage, using flutes 8' and 4' on the Positiv division.
